Output d8adb6c25a4e1a74ac90fe1775e6504cdca71cb8756cf27e23444ea17fba783c:1

value
1347397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58cfb52410386d1b824c77404a3283081ce2014a OP_EQUAL
address
39ncDCb5TKJHbAtf1QVpcctJAYYci6JvQV
transaction
d8adb6c25a4e1a74ac90fe1775e6504cdca71cb8756cf27e23444ea17fba783c
confirmations
270810
spent
true